Rare Vision Photography Lifestyle photographer specializing in families, newborns and branding. Hello, my name is Nicole and I'm the owner/photographer of Rare Vision Photography.

Rare Vision was formed out of my passion for capturing moments and the beauty and uniqueness that God displays in each of them. I'm passionate about photography because it's more than an art form, it's unfolding a story. Stories are full of laughter, fear, fantasy, heartache, mischief, heroes, love, passion and so much more. Photographs capture the great times in a person's story and freezes it in

time for us to remember and savor for years to come. I've enjoyed capturing emotions and events in my own story and would be privileged to capture a special moment in yours.
